About the job

The Chief Engineer (CE) for Germany is responsible for protecting the value and operational functionality of the company’s property assets in Hamburg/Berlin/Frankfurt and Leipzig. The CE will be based in Hamburg.
The CE is responsible for ensuring that all areas of the property and surrounds are safe and welcoming, working closely with key internal and external stakeholders to deliver the required business standards in all areas. This includes short and long-term planning and day-to-day operations of the engineering division. The CE recommends the department’s budget and capital expenditures and manage expenses within approved budget constraints.
1 - Managing & developing a team
In collaboration with the Department Heads, manage, motivate and develop the Engineering team.
Ensure all department and individual targets and goals are achieved, monitor and review the performance of the individuals on a regular basis, providing accurate and timely feedback and where required, coaching on areas for improvement.
2 - Utilities Procurement and Management
Procure optimum energy and utility contracts including electricity, gas and water.
Consistently review, identify and propose cost effective utilities and energy efficiency initiatives ensuring successful implementation across the business.
3 - Repairs and Maintenance
Manage repairs and maintenance throughout, ensuring that the building and surrounds are safe, compliant and a welcoming environment.
Undertake plumbing, carpentry, decorating, electrical and mechanical engineering work as necessary to maintain safe and efficient systems within all the properties.
Ensure adequate spares are maintained and effectively used in order to maintain a consistently high standard of maintenance.
Ensure that all works undertaken are done safely and in accordance with the relevant codes of practice.
Respond to all the maintenance requests in order of priority set out by the properties or by your own initiative.
Have a thorough knowledge of the layout of the different properties and specifically all items of plant and equipment with log recording of tests, routines and inspections carried out on regular basis.
Work closely with all relevant managers to accurately assess, identify and address repairs and maintenance issues in a cost effective and timely manner.
4 - Tenders and Contracts
Maintain an accurate diary system for all individual contractors. Creating a Planned Preventative Maintenance schedule.
Prepare tender documents for the procurement of all services linked to the engineering department.
Fully research, calculate and compare costs for required goods and services to achieve maximum benefit through the tender process.
5 - Compliance and legal obligations
Ensure business compliance with all legislative requirements, including the timely compilation of statutory reporting.
- Example: COSSH (substances hazardous to health), health and safety, hygiene policies, fire regulations etc…
To create weekly rotas for supervising department according to business needs and German working time legislation, to ensure that the employees respect the regulations of German working time act.
Ensure that appropriate and cost-effective systems, policies, processes and procedures are designed, implemented and adhered to.
Keep up to date with legislation and best practice to develop effective proposals on how to address legal requirements and improve existing working practices.
6 - Budgets & Forecasts
Collate and evaluate relevant internal and external data (including costs), proposing annual facilities budgets and financial forecasts.
Prepare and plan Capex budget for all properties in coordination with the respective General Managers.
Ensure all departmental expenditure is in line with budgets and forecasts and the smooth administration of the purchase order system.
Work with the Finance Department to ensure prompt payment of invoices and resolution of issues.
7 - Reporting and Analysis
Provide monthly reports and analysis showing all Engineering Management related tasks, works trackers and costs.
Manage and report all emergencies and complaints using the procedures set by Frasers Hospitality.
Provide monthly utility usage reports.
8 - Communication
Work and communicate effectively with all key stakeholders (e.g. Hotel GM, Front of House Manager, Operations Manager, Housekeeping Manager, Construction, Contractors and external advisors/providers) to gain their full engagement in the design, planning and implementation of all facilities related initiatives, activities and standards.
9 - Environmental friendly policies
Implement cost effective environmental friendly initiatives that benefit both the community and business.
Ensure best value and management is being obtained from all external waste and recycling providers.
